Interdisciplinary teams offer potential advantages over siloed care models in complex
cardiovascular disease management. Consensus guidelines for aortic management have
increasingly identified the interdisciplinary aortic team as a key component in delivering
quality care. Acute aortic syndromes are a subset of high acuity and lethal aortic
pathologies that may benefit from an interdisciplinary approach. The advantages of
the interdisciplinary aortic team model in the management of acute aortic syndromes
and barriers to implementation are discussed.
